Stoney Creek Villa 299 is a roomy condo located just steps from the stores and eateries at Harbour Town. It was completely updated in 2023 with brand-new floor throughout. Inside, this impressive vacation rental features an updated, full kitchen with new appliances and fixtures, a dining room, and a comfortable living area with access to the private, furnished patio with a landscaped view. Its open-concept living space ensures the group chef will never be kept out of lively conversations while whipping up a feast everybody will remember. Indulge together at the dining table while appreciating the view out of the patio door. Afterward, go for a invigorating swim in the sizable, shared pool before winding down for the nighttime.

This Sea Pines vacation rental is near the Harbour Town Links Golf Course, home of the famed RBC Heritage tournament, with convenient access to waterfront shopping and dining. Additional resort activities include trail rides through Lawton Stables, marina activities at Harbour Town or South Beach, dining, shopping, kayak units, and miles of bicycle paths.

Whether you’re looking for the ideal golf hideaway or a family fun vacation spot, Stoney Creek Villa 299 is the ideal choice for everybody.

About the Area

Located by the sea, this condo is in Sea Pines, a neighborhood in Hilton Head Island. Harbour Town Golf Links and Atlantic Dunes by Davis Love III are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Sea Pines Forest Preserve and Newhall Audubon Nature Preserve. Lawton Stables and The Sandbox are also worth visiting. Be sure to check out the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.

Hilton Head vacation rental home tips:

When to visit Hilton Head & When to book:

  • Book your rental as early as possible. Rental schedules often open 12 months in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many groups reserve their Summer vacation rentals during Winter holiday get-togethers.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• To get the best value, try shifting your vacation week to the Spring or Fall shoulder seasons. May, September, and even October offer pleasant temperatures, fewer crowds, and reduced traffic.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property management company or host if your vacationing group qualifies for a discount.
  • Property managers typically offer renters an option to obtain v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which generally cost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any days missed as a result of med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or extra gasoline expenses. Trip insurance can be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Find a copy of your local Hilton Head area mag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local shops and fuel stations. In addition to great local stories, visitors guide magazines have offers and deals for local shops and restaurants.

During your stay:

  • Put the owner's contact information in your smartphone.
  • Property managers are there to help! Feel free to ask any quest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Lock your rental home while you're away. Protect the owner's property and your stuff!
  • During check-in, note any damages to the property and immediately contact the owner. Record all correspondence in case a dispute arises.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. You will magnify your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ors are a fantastic source for finding the best local beaches and restaurants.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Neighbors can often point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for bird watching?
  • Double-check every room of the vacation property to confirm that you've packed everything on check-out day. Make sure to check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
  • Remember to leave feedback! Property owners rely on great feedback to drive future reservations. They'll be grateful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other families will be thankful you shared your experience and help them have the best future vacation.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to fix it.
